Intel Arc A370M vs NVIDIA RTX 1000 Mobile Ada Generation

We compared two Mobile platform GPUs: 4GB VRAM Arc A370M and 6GB VRAM RTX 1000 Mobile Ada Generation to see which GPU has better performance in key specifications, benchmark tests, power consumption, etc.

Main Differences

NVIDIA RTX 1000 Mobile Ada Generation 's Advantages
Released 1 years and 11 months late
Boost Clock has increased by 31% (2025MHz vs 1550MHz)
More VRAM (6GB vs 4GB)
Larger VRAM bandwidth (192.0GB/s vs 112.0GB/s)
1536 additional rendering cores
